To provide our players suitably challenging competition we have been able to arrange opportunities for our teams to travel to Canada, Sweden, Netherlands, UK and USA. We have been invited to play against top European teams ranging from Manchester City and Ajax in prestigious tournaments including Oakham, UK and Rood Wit, Netherlands.
The Rood Wit tournament is an annual competition for 24 of the best European U10 academy teams and a small selection of grassroots teams who are invited to play in a ranking tournament. Legendary Dutch football coach, Guus Hiddink completed the 2024 draw, noting that the Rood Wit tournament is one of the best U10 tournaments in the world for youth competition.
In 2025 we will take part in the tournament for the 6th straight year with our highest ranking being 5th and 8th. With the exposure to play against teams such as Liverpool, PSV and Atletico Madrid, our players are expected to perform at a high level in an effort to win games following our guiding principles.
In 2025 we will visit the largest youth tournament in the world, the Gothia Cup for the 2nd time. With this tournament taking place at the end of the season it is the final opportunity for our players and coaches to showcase their level and skill against teams from all parts of the world. Teams from Africa, South America and Asia are drawn to Gothenburg to be crowned World Champions of the grassroots community.
Since 2019 our travel programme has grown from one trip per season to ten teams travelling to represent 345 FC in the 2024/2025 season. We hand select the tournaments and destinations that we visit to ensure the quality of the tournament and opposition being suitably challenging for our players. We have had successes winning various tournaments from the Easter International Cup 2022, Springs Holiday Cup 2023 and consistently ranking higher than other professional academies in the Rood Wit tournament.
